공부/DB
-
데이터의 정합성과 무결성공부/DB 2024. 11. 10. 16:58
정합성과 무결성. 언뜻 봐도 중요하다.둘 다 중요하지만 뭐가 다른지 gpt 에게 물어보자나 : 데이터의 정합성과 무결성에 대해 설명해줘GPT : 데이터의 정합성과 무결성은 데이터베이스와 시스템에서 매우 중요한 개념입니다. 두 개념 모두 데이터가 정확하고 신뢰할 수 있는 상태를 유지하도록 보장하는 데 중점을 둡니다.데이터 정합성 (Data Consistency)정합성은 데이터가 일관되고 서로 모순되지 않으며 정확하게 유지되는 상태를 말합니다. 주로 데이터의 중복이나 데이터의 모순을 방지하고자 할 때 사용하는 개념입니다. 예를 들어, 고객의 정보가 여러 테이블에 걸쳐 있을 때 모든 테이블에 동일한 정보가 일관되게 저장되어 있어야 정합성이 유지됩니다. 데이터 정합성을 유지하기 위한 방법에는 데이터베이스의 트랜..
-
Docker 로 로컬에 mysql 실행공부/DB 2024. 10. 29. 02:04
개인으로 간단하게 프로젝트 혹은 테스트를 할 때 mysql 을 자주 쓰는거같다Docker 를 알고 명령어로만 만들어진 이미지를 실행시키면 로컬에 디비가 띄워진다는게 정말 간편하다docker run -d --name mysql-container -e MYSQL_ROOT_PASSWORD=your_root_password -e MYSQL_DATABASE=your_database_name -e MYSQL_USER=your_user -e MYSQL_PASSWORD=your_password -p 3306:3306 mysql:latest명령어가 길어서 다음 줄에 입력하고 싶은데 엔터를 누르면 실행이 된다cmd 에서는 ^powershell 에서는 `ubuntu 에서는 를 쓰면 줄바꿀 할 수 있..